Chemical Name

Methylene blue trihydrate

Synonyms

Basic Blue 9 trihydrate; 3,7-Bis(dimethylamino)phenothiazin-5-ium chloride

Molecular formula

C16H18CLN3S·3H2O

CAS No.

7220-79-3

Molecular weight

373.90

Details

Appearance: Bottle green crystal or crystalline powder with gunmetal shine, without smell.

Assay: 98.0% min

Change color range: Passes test

Solubility in ethanol: Passes test

Loss on drying: 15%max

Sulfated ash: 0.5%max

Biological stain: Passes test  

As: 0.0005%max

Cu: 0.03%max

Zn: 0.02%max

Solubility: soluble in water, ethanol and chloroform, insoluble in aether, water solution is blue.

Packing: 25kg/ fibre drum

Main Application

Used for REDOX indicator, adsorption indicator and biological dyeing agents.

 

What is the use of methylene blue trihydrate?


Methylene blue trihydrate is a versatile compound primarily used in medical and biological applications. In medicine, it serves as an antidote for methemoglobinemia, converting abnormal methemoglobin back to functional hemoglobin. The trihydrate form is particularly valued in laboratory settings for histological staining and as a redox indicator in biochemical experiments. Aquaculture industries utilize it as an antifungal and antiparasitic treatment for fish. Its ability to stain living cells makes it valuable for microscopy, especially in nervous tissue visualization. The trihydrate formulation offers improved stability and solubility compared to anhydrous forms, making it preferable for precise pharmaceutical preparations and diagnostic procedures.

 

Is methylene blue trihydrate the same as methylene blue?


Methylene blue trihydrate and methylene blue share the same active compound but differ in their hydration state. The trihydrate form contains three water molecules (C₁₆H₁₈ClN₃S·3H₂O) per molecule of methylene blue, while the anhydrous version lacks these water molecules. This hydration affects physical properties like solubility and stability, with the trihydrate being more soluble in aqueous solutions. Pharmacologically, both forms have identical therapeutic effects as the water molecules dissociate in solution. However, the trihydrate is generally preferred for laboratory use due to its consistent performance in staining applications and better handling characteristics in powder form.

 

What is the difference between methyl blue and methylene blue?


Methyl blue and methylene blue are distinct chemical compounds with different structures and applications. Methyl blue (CI 42780) is a triarylmethane dye used primarily as a biological stain and pH indicator, while methylene blue (CI 52015) is a phenothiazine derivative with medical applications. Structurally, methyl blue contains multiple sulfonated aromatic rings, making it more water-soluble but less permeable through cell membranes. Methylene blue's smaller molecular size allows it to penetrate cells and participate in redox reactions, enabling its use in medical treatments. Their staining properties also differ significantly - methyl blue preferentially stains connective tissues, whereas methylene blue is used for nervous tissue and microbial staining.
